The Model Maker II will work with various composite and 3D printed materials and maintain the work area in a clean and orderly condition. The Model Maker II will perform independent project tasks and collaborate with customers and team members.

As a Model Maker II, you will be responsible for:

  • Surfacing and fitting components for dimensionally accurate assemblies
  • Performing body work, priming, and painting with various methods
  • Using blueprints, drawings, Computer Aided Design (CAD), and verbal directions to create models according to established specifications
  • Using precision measuring instruments
  • Laminating with epoxy resins and carbon composites
  • Operating shop equipment, including bridgeport, lathe, and MIG welder, and performing preventive maintenance
  • Interfacing with engineering and cross functional teams to meet product requirements and customer acceptance
  • Notifying appropriate personnel of problems or potential problems related to machine operation
  • Participating in daily shop organization and clean-up

To be considered as a Model Maker II, you will need:

  • High school diploma or equivalent
  • Minimum 4 years of experience in prototyping
  • Mechanical ability and ability to operate shop equipment
  • Good attention to detail and organizational skills
  • Able to work independently and as part of a team
  • Has own tools with toolbox
  • Ability to read, comprehend and execute written and verbal instructions.

A successful candidate may also have:

  • Certificate in Autobody, Automotive Technology or related field
  • Valid driver’s license
  • Ability to work overtime as needed including weekends
